    Summary: general multi-lingual speech synthesis system
    Description: 
    Festival is a general purpose text-to-speech system.  As well as
    simply rendering text as speech it can be used in an interactive
    command mode for testing and developing various aspects of speech
    synthesis technology.
    
    Festival offers a full text to speech system with various APIs, as
     well an environment for development and research of speech synthesis
     techniques. It includes a Scheme-based command interpreter.
    
     Besides research into speech synthesis, festival is useful as a
     stand-alone speech synthesis program. It is capable of producing
     clearly understandable speech from text.
